Pesquisar
Close this search box.
Edit Content
Click on the Edit Content button to edit/add the content.

O que é yokeable

O que é yokeable?

Yokeable é um termo que se refere a uma abordagem de desenvolvimento de aplicativos móveis que permite a integração de diferentes componentes e serviços de forma modular. Essa técnica é especialmente útil em ambientes de desenvolvimento ágil, onde a flexibilidade e a adaptabilidade são essenciais para atender às demandas do mercado. O conceito de yokeable se baseia na ideia de que os desenvolvedores podem “yoke” (ou unir) diferentes partes de um aplicativo, facilitando a criação de soluções mais robustas e escaláveis.

Características do yokeable

Uma das principais características do yokeable é a sua capacidade de promover a reutilização de código. Isso significa que os desenvolvedores podem criar módulos que podem ser utilizados em diferentes partes do aplicativo ou até mesmo em diferentes projetos. Essa abordagem não apenas economiza tempo, mas também reduz a probabilidade de erros, uma vez que o código já foi testado e validado em outras aplicações. Além disso, a modularidade permite que as equipes de desenvolvimento trabalhem em paralelo, aumentando a eficiência do processo de criação.

Benefícios do uso de yokeable no desenvolvimento de apps

O uso de yokeable no desenvolvimento de aplicativos móveis traz diversos benefícios. Um dos mais significativos é a agilidade no desenvolvimento. Com a possibilidade de integrar componentes de forma rápida e eficiente, as equipes podem lançar atualizações e novas funcionalidades com maior frequência. Outro benefício é a facilidade de manutenção. Como os módulos são independentes, é possível realizar alterações em uma parte do aplicativo sem afetar o funcionamento das demais, o que minimiza riscos e interrupções.

Yokeable e a experiência do usuário

Além de facilitar o desenvolvimento, o conceito de yokeable também impacta positivamente a experiência do usuário. Aplicativos que utilizam essa abordagem tendem a ser mais responsivos e estáveis, uma vez que os componentes são otimizados para funcionar em conjunto. Isso resulta em um desempenho superior e em uma interface mais intuitiva, o que é crucial para a retenção de usuários. A modularidade também permite que os desenvolvedores testem diferentes combinações de funcionalidades, proporcionando uma experiência personalizada e adaptada às necessidades dos usuários.

Exemplos de yokeable em aplicativos móveis

Vários aplicativos populares utilizam a abordagem yokeable em seu desenvolvimento. Por exemplo, plataformas de e-commerce frequentemente integram módulos de pagamento, gerenciamento de estoque e análise de dados, permitindo que cada um funcione de maneira independente, mas em harmonia com os demais. Outro exemplo são os aplicativos de redes sociais, que combinam diferentes serviços, como mensagens, notificações e feeds de notícias, utilizando a modularidade para oferecer uma experiência coesa e fluida aos usuários.

Desafios do yokeable

Apesar das inúmeras vantagens, a implementação do yokeable também apresenta desafios. Um dos principais é a necessidade de uma arquitetura bem planejada. Para que os módulos funcionem corretamente em conjunto, é fundamental que os desenvolvedores sigam padrões de codificação e design consistentes. Além disso, a comunicação entre os diferentes componentes deve ser cuidadosamente gerenciada para evitar conflitos e garantir que os dados sejam trocados de maneira eficiente.

Ferramentas que suportam o yokeable

Existem várias ferramentas e frameworks que facilitam a implementação do yokeable no desenvolvimento de aplicativos móveis. Por exemplo, bibliotecas como React e Angular permitem a criação de componentes reutilizáveis, enquanto plataformas como Docker ajudam a gerenciar a integração de diferentes serviços. Essas ferramentas não apenas simplificam o processo de desenvolvimento, mas também oferecem suporte para testes e manutenção, garantindo que os aplicativos permaneçam atualizados e funcionais ao longo do tempo.

O futuro do yokeable no desenvolvimento de apps

Com o avanço da tecnologia e a crescente demanda por aplicativos mais complexos e interativos, a abordagem yokeable tende a se tornar cada vez mais relevante. À medida que as equipes de desenvolvimento buscam maneiras de otimizar seus processos e melhorar a experiência do usuário, a modularidade e a flexibilidade proporcionadas pelo yokeable se destacam como soluções eficazes. Espera-se que, no futuro, mais empresas adotem essa abordagem, resultando em aplicativos mais inovadores e eficientes.

Yokeable e a integração de APIs

A integração de APIs (Interfaces de Programação de Aplicações) é um aspecto crucial do yokeable. Ao permitir que diferentes serviços se comuniquem entre si, as APIs possibilitam que os desenvolvedores “yoke” funcionalidades externas aos seus aplicativos. Isso não apenas enriquece a experiência do usuário, mas também amplia as capacidades do aplicativo, permitindo que ele se conecte a serviços de terceiros, como redes sociais, sistemas de pagamento e plataformas de análise de dados.

Considerações finais sobre yokeable

Em suma, o conceito de yokeable representa uma evolução significativa na forma como os aplicativos móveis são desenvolvidos. Com sua ênfase na modularidade, reutilização de código e integração de serviços, essa abordagem oferece uma série de benefícios que podem transformar a maneira como as equipes de desenvolvimento operam. À medida que o mercado continua a evoluir, o yokeable se posiciona como uma estratégia essencial para criar aplicativos móveis de alta qualidade e com excelente desempenho.

Share this :